Introduction
Renewable energy refers to energy obtained from natural sources that are continuously replenished, such as sunlight, wind, and water. Unlike fossil fuels, renewable energy sources are sustainable and environmentally friendly.
India has been actively promoting renewable energy to reduce dependence on fossil fuels, combat climate change, and ensure energy security. With abundant natural resources, the country has significant potential to expand renewable energy production.
The government has launched several initiatives to increase renewable energy capacity and promote sustainable development.
Meaning of Renewable Energy
Renewable energy is energy derived from natural sources that are replenished naturally over time and do not get depleted with use.
Major renewable energy sources include:
-
Solar energy
-
Wind energy
-
Hydropower
-
Biomass energy
-
Geothermal energy
Among these, solar, wind, and hydro energy are the most widely used renewable energy sources in India.
Solar Energy in India
Solar energy is generated by converting sunlight into electricity using photovoltaic (PV) cells.
India has significant solar potential due to its geographical location and high solar radiation. Large-scale solar power plants and rooftop solar systems are being developed across the country.
The government launched the National Solar Mission to promote solar energy production and reduce reliance on fossil fuels.
India has also initiated the International Solar Alliance to promote solar energy adoption among tropical countries.
Major solar parks have been developed in states such as Rajasthan, Gujarat, and Karnataka.
Wind Energy in India
Wind energy is generated by converting the kinetic energy of wind into electricity using wind turbines.
India is among the leading countries in wind power generation. Several coastal and windy regions provide favorable conditions for wind energy production.
Major wind energy producing states include:
-
Tamil Nadu
-
Gujarat
-
Maharashtra
-
Karnataka
-
Rajasthan
Wind energy contributes significantly to India’s renewable energy capacity.
Hydropower in India
Hydropower is generated by using the energy of flowing or falling water to produce electricity.
Large dams and hydroelectric power plants convert water energy into electrical power.
Hydropower plays an important role in India’s energy mix and provides a reliable source of renewable electricity.
Important hydropower projects include the Bhakra Nangal Dam, which contributes significantly to power generation and irrigation.
Hydropower also supports water management and flood control.
Government Initiatives for Renewable Energy
The Government of India has introduced several policies and programs to promote renewable energy development.
Key initiatives include:
-
National Solar Mission
-
Wind Energy Development Programs
-
Green Energy Corridor Project
-
Production Linked Incentive (PLI) scheme for solar manufacturing
These initiatives aim to increase renewable energy capacity and encourage investment in clean energy technologies.
Benefits of Renewable Energy
Renewable energy offers several economic and environmental benefits.
1. Environmental Protection
Renewable energy sources produce little or no greenhouse gas emissions, helping reduce air pollution and combat climate change.
2. Energy Security
Expanding renewable energy reduces dependence on imported fossil fuels.
3. Sustainable Development
Renewable energy promotes sustainable economic growth and resource conservation.
4. Employment Generation
The renewable energy sector creates job opportunities in manufacturing, installation, and maintenance.
Challenges in Renewable Energy Development
Despite rapid progress, renewable energy development in India faces certain challenges.
1. High Initial Investment
Setting up renewable energy infrastructure requires significant capital investment.
2. Intermittent Energy Supply
Solar and wind energy depend on weather conditions, which can affect energy generation.
3. Land and Infrastructure Constraints
Large renewable energy projects require significant land and grid infrastructure.
Addressing these challenges is essential for expanding renewable energy capacity.
